Savory Curry Puff Recipe: Flaky Comfort in Every Bite

There’s something truly delightful about biting into a warm, flaky pastry and discovering a savory treasure inside. These Potato and Chickpea Curry Puffs bring that joy to life, beautifully melding the rich flavors of spices and creamy coconut milk. As I prepared these golden puffs for a recent gathering, the kitchen filled with the exciting aromas of ginger, garlic, and curry powder — instantly transporting me to the bustling street stalls of Southeast Asia.

Perfect as a hearty snack or an impressive appetizer, these vegetarian delights are not just easy to make but also incredibly versatile. With just a few ingredients and ready-made puff pastry, you can whip up a batch that will impress your family and friends. If you’re looking to break away from the monotony of takeout, give these curry puffs a try; I promise they’ll become a favorite in your recipe rotation!

Why are Curry Puffs a must-try?

Irresistible Flakiness: The buttery puff pastry gives each bite a delightful crunch, creating a satisfying contrast with the soft filling.

Flavor Explosion: Infused with aromatic spices, every curry puff bursts with warm, savory goodness that tantalizes your taste buds.

Quick and Easy: Utilizing store-bought puff pastry makes this recipe a breeze, perfect for busy weeknights or last-minute gatherings.

Versatile Delight: Customize the filling with your favorite veggies or spices to suit any palate, ensuring everyone at the table is happy.

Crowd-Pleasing Appetizer: Serve them warm at parties, and watch as guests flock to these golden treasures, eager for seconds!

For more awesome snack ideas, check out our Appetizer Recipes for inspiration!

Curry Puff Ingredients

For the Filling
Garbanzo Beans – Provides protein and a nutty flavor; substitute with canned white beans for a similar texture.
Olive Oil – Used for sautéing vegetables; can be replaced with canola oil for a neutral taste.
Yellow Onion – Adds sweetness and depth; use shallots for a milder flavor if desired.
Garlic – Enhances overall flavor with its aromatic touch; fresh is always best!
Ginger – Contributes warmth and spice; fresh ginger maximizes flavor.
Yukon Gold Potatoes – Offers creaminess and structure; substitute with Russet potatoes for a fluffier texture.
Curry Powder – Provides the signature flavor; feel free to use your favorite curry blend for unique tastes.
Ground Turmeric – Adds color and earthiness to the filling.
Cumin – Enhances the flavor profile with its warm, earthy notes.
Sugar – Balances the spices; you can omit it for a less sweet flavor.
Kosher Salt – Essential for seasoning; adjust to your taste.
Black Pepper – Adds heat and depth of flavor.
Coconut Milk – Introduces creaminess with a subtle sweetness; swap for heavy cream for a richer filling.

For the Pastry
Puff Pastry – The star of this recipe, providing the flaky, crispy exterior; Dufour is highly recommended.
All-purpose Flour – Used for dusting your work surface to prevent sticking.
Egg – For an egg wash, ensuring a beautifully golden-brown finish; you can substitute with milk or a plant-based alternative for vegan options.
Water – Used to thin the egg wash for an even application.

These curry puff ingredients come together effortlessly to create a mouthwatering appetizer that everyone will love!

How to Make Curry Puffs

  1. Heat Oil: Warm olive oil in a skillet over medium-high heat. Add ginger and garlic, sautéing them for about 3 minutes until fragrant and golden, infusing your kitchen with tantalizing aromas.

  2. Cook Onion: Toss in the diced onion, cooking for about 6-7 minutes until it turns translucent. Keep an eye on it to prevent browning, as you want a sweet base for your filling.

  3. Add Potatoes: Stir in the cubed Yukon Gold potatoes and cook until they’re fork-tender, which should take around 20 minutes. Add a splash of water if they stick to the pan; the key is a soft texture.

  4. Mix Fillings: Incorporate garbanzo beans, curry powder, turmeric, cumin, sugar, salt, and pepper into the mix. Cook for about 3 minutes, allowing the flavors to meld beautifully.

  5. Stir in Coconut Milk: Pour in the coconut milk, cooking until the mixture thickens, about 2 minutes. Allow the filling to cool completely, ensuring your pastry doesn’t get soggy.

  6. Prepare Puff Pastry: Roll out the puff pastry and cut it into 8 squares. Place about 2 tablespoons of the cooled filling on one side of each square, making sure not to overfill.

  7. Seal Edges: Fold the pastry over the filling and crimp the edges using a fork. Make sure they’re tightly sealed to keep all that wonderful flavor inside!

  8. Chill the Puffs: Place the filled puffs in the fridge for about 20 minutes. This step helps them maintain their shape while baking and promotes a flakier texture.

  9. Preheat and Bake: Preheat your oven to 400°F (200°C). Bake the puffs for 15-19 minutes, or until they’re golden brown and puffed up like little clouds.

  10. Cool Before Serving: Let the curry puffs cool for 10 minutes after taking them out of the oven. This helps them firm up and makes them easier to handle without burning your fingers.

Optional: Serve with sweet chili sauce or chutney for a delicious dipping experience.

Exact quantities are listed in the recipe card below.

Curry Puff

What to Serve with Potato and Chickpea Curry Puffs?

Elevate your dining experience with delightful side dishes and dips that pair beautifully with these flaky treats.

  • Sweet Chili Sauce: The perfect balance of sweetness and spice enhances the savory curry filling, making every bite irresistible.

  • Coconut Rice: This creamy, aromatic rice adds a lovely tropical touch, complementing the rich flavors in each curry puff. Its slight sweetness ties the meal together beautifully.

  • Mixed Green Salad: A refreshing salad with zesty dressing cuts through the richness of the puffs. Think crisp lettuce, tangy tomatoes, and a simple lemon vinaigrette for contrast.

  • Mango Chutney: A dollop of this fruity condiment provides a fruity contrast to the savory filling, intensifying the overall flavor profile with its sweet and savory notes.

  • Spiced Lentil Soup: A warm, hearty lentil soup adds depth and nourishment to the meal. Its earthy flavors harmonize with the spices in the curry puffs, creating a wholesome combination.

  • Yogurt Dip: Creamy yogurt with mint or cilantro creates a cooling contrast to the spices. It’s a refreshing way to enhance the flavors and make every bite even more enjoyable.

With these delightful accompaniments, your Potato and Chickpea Curry Puffs will shine even brighter on the dinner table!

Curry Puff Variations

Feel free to explore these delightful variations to take your curry puffs to the next level of yum!

  • Sweet Potato Swap: Replace Yukon Gold potatoes with sweet potatoes for a naturally sweeter flavor that pairs perfectly with spices.

  • Extra Spice: Add a teaspoon of garam masala or coriander for an aromatic boost that deepens the flavor profile.

  • Veggie Mix-In: Toss in some peas or finely diced carrots for a splash of color and added nutrition in every bite.

  • Heat Factor: For spice lovers, include finely chopped jalapeños or a dash of cayenne pepper in the filling to turn up the heat.

  • Cheesy Twist: Mix in crumbled feta or shredded cheese into the filling for a creamier, indulgent experience that melts in your mouth.

  • Herbal Infusion: Stir in fresh chopped cilantro or mint into the filling just before sealing for a refreshing twist that elevates the flavor.

  • Coconut Cream Richness: Use coconut cream instead of coconut milk for a richer, creamier filling that truly satisfies.

  • Vegan Option: Swap the egg wash for almond milk or soy milk to keep these delicious puffs 100% plant-based without losing any flakiness.

How to Store and Freeze Curry Puffs

Fridge: Store leftover curry puffs in an airtight container for up to 5 days. To keep them crispy, reheat in a toaster oven for the best results.

Freezer: For longer storage, freeze uncooked curry puffs on a baking sheet until firm, then transfer to a zip-top bag. They can be frozen for up to 3 months. Bake from frozen, adding an extra few minutes to the cooking time.

Thawing: When ready to enjoy, thaw the frozen curry puffs in the refrigerator overnight before baking, ensuring even cooking and perfect flakiness.

Reheating: To reheat cooked curry puffs, use a toaster oven or conventional oven at 350°F (175°C) for about 10-15 minutes until heated through and crispy. Enjoy every bite of your delicious curry puffs!

Expert Tips for Perfect Curry Puffs

Cool the Filling: Always allow your filling to cool completely before sealing your curry puffs. This prevents soggy pastry and ensures a perfect bite!

Watch the Browning: Keep an eye on your puffs while baking. Oven temperatures can vary; check them to avoid over-browning or burning.

Crimping Technique: Use a gentle hand when crimping the edges of the pastry to help maintain the puff’s height during baking.

Puff Pastry Quality: Opt for a high-quality puff pastry like Dufour. The flakiness of your curry puffs depends on the pastry you use!

Customize Fillings: Feel free to experiment! Adding extra spices or vegetables like peas can elevate your curry puffs and tailor them to your taste essentials.

Make Ahead Options

These delicious Potato and Chickpea Curry Puffs are perfect for meal prep enthusiasts! You can prepare the filling up to 3 days in advance; simply follow the recipe through step 5 and let it cool completely before storing it in an airtight container in the refrigerator. To maintain that irresistible flaky quality, assemble the puffs just before baking. Chill the sealed puffs for 20 minutes before placing them in the oven, or freeze them for up to 1 month. When ready to enjoy, bake straight from the freezer for an additional 5 minutes, and you’ll have warm, golden curry puffs that are just as delightful as if made fresh!

Curry Puff

Potato and Chickpea Curry Puff Recipe FAQs

How do I choose ripe ingredients for my curry puffs?
Absolutely! When selecting potatoes, look for Yukon Golds that are firm, without any dark spots or wrinkles for the best texture. For chickpeas, if using canned, ensure they’re well-drained and rinsed. Fresh garlic and ginger should be firm and fragrant, while onions should have a smooth skin. Just avoid any soft or discolored ones!

How should I store leftover curry puffs?
Very easy! Store any leftover curry puffs in an airtight container in the fridge for up to 5 days. To maintain their delightful crispiness, I recommend reheating them in a toaster oven instead of a microwave, as this will preserve that flaky texture beautifully.

Can I freeze my curry puffs for later?
Absolutely! To freeze uncooked curry puffs, lay them out on a baking sheet and freeze until firm. After that, transfer them to a zip-top bag and they can be stored for up to 3 months. When you’re ready to bake, no need to thaw; just add 2-3 extra minutes to the baking time for perfectly puffed pastries!

What should I do if my pastry doesn’t puff up while baking?
If your curry puffs aren’t puffing as expected, check the quality of your puff pastry—high-quality brands like Dufour work wonders! Also, ensure you’ve chilled the puffs for 20 minutes before baking; this step is crucial for achieving that light, airy texture. Lastly, remember not to overcrowd the baking sheet, as this allows heat to circulate properly.

Are there any dietary considerations I should keep in mind?
Definitely! Chickpeas are a fantastic source of protein for vegetarians and can be an excellent choice for gluten-free diets if you use gluten-free puff pastry. Also, for vegan options, you can substitute the egg wash with plant-based milk. Always check each ingredient for potential allergens, especially if serving guests with dietary restrictions!

How can I customize my curry puff filling?
Oh, the more the merrier! You can easily modify the filling by adding in veggies like peas or carrots, or even spices like garam masala for a different flavor profile. Sweet potatoes can be swapped in for Yukon Golds for a sweeter twist on the classic recipe! Just make sure whatever you add complements the overall flavor of the curry powder.

Curry Puff

Savory Curry Puff Recipe: Flaky Comfort in Every Bite

These delicious Curry Puffs are a must-try, featuring a savory filling of potato and chickpeas wrapped in flaky pastry.
Prep Time 30 minutes
Cook Time 40 minutes
Chilling Time 20 minutes
Total Time 1 hour 30 minutes
Servings: 8 puffs
Course: APPETIZERS
Cuisine: Southeast Asian
Calories: 250

Ingredients
  

For the Filling
  • 1 can Garbanzo Beans Substitute with canned white beans for similar texture.
  • 2 tablespoons Olive Oil Can be replaced with canola oil.
  • 1 medium Yellow Onion Use shallots for a milder flavor if desired.
  • 2 cloves Garlic Fresh is always best!
  • 1 inch Ginger Use fresh ginger for maximum flavor.
  • 2 medium Yukon Gold Potatoes Substitute with Russet potatoes for fluffier texture.
  • 1 tablespoon Curry Powder Feel free to use your favorite curry blend.
  • 1 teaspoon Ground Turmeric
  • 1 teaspoon Cumin
  • 1 teaspoon Sugar Omit it for a less sweet flavor.
  • 1 teaspoon Kosher Salt Adjust to your taste.
  • 1/2 teaspoon Black Pepper
  • 1 cup Coconut Milk Swap for heavy cream for a richer filling.
For the Pastry
  • 1 sheet Puff Pastry Dufour is highly recommended.
  • 1 tablespoon All-purpose Flour For dusting your work surface.
  • 1 large Egg For egg wash; substitute with milk for vegan options.
  • 1 tablespoon Water Used to thin the egg wash.

Equipment

  • Skillet
  • Baking Sheet
  • oven
  • Rolling Pin
  • fork

Method
 

Directions
  1. Heat olive oil in a skillet over medium-high heat. Add ginger and garlic, sauté for about 3 minutes until fragrant and golden.
  2. Toss in the diced onion, cooking for about 6-7 minutes until it turns translucent.
  3. Stir in the cubed Yukon Gold potatoes and cook until fork-tender, about 20 minutes.
  4. Incorporate garbanzo beans, curry powder, turmeric, cumin, sugar, salt, and pepper into the mix. Cook for about 3 minutes.
  5. Pour in the coconut milk, cooking until the mixture thickens, about 2 minutes.
  6. Roll out the puff pastry and cut it into 8 squares. Place about 2 tablespoons of cooled filling on one side of each square.
  7. Fold the pastry over the filling and crimp the edges using a fork.
  8. Place the filled puffs in the fridge for about 20 minutes.
  9. Preheat your oven to 400°F (200°C). Bake the puffs for 15-19 minutes, until golden brown.
  10. Let the curry puffs cool for 10 minutes before serving.

Nutrition

Serving: 1puffCalories: 250kcalCarbohydrates: 30gProtein: 5gFat: 12gSaturated Fat: 3gPolyunsaturated Fat: 0.5gMonounsaturated Fat: 8gCholesterol: 50mgSodium: 300mgPotassium: 350mgFiber: 4gSugar: 1gVitamin A: 5IUVitamin C: 10mgCalcium: 2mgIron: 8mg

Notes

Serve with sweet chili sauce or chutney for a delicious dipping experience.

Tried this recipe?

Let us know how it was!

Leave a Comment

Recipe Rating